James Risen, in Tense Testimony, Refuses to Offer Clues on Sources — ALEXANDRIA, Va. — James Risen, a reporter for The New York Times, took the witness stand in federal court on Monday and refused to answer any questions that could help the Justice Department home in on his confidential sources.


POLITICO hires Marilyn Thompson as deputy editor — POLITICO has hired Marilyn Thompson as a deputy editor, POLITICO editor Susan Glasser and executive editor Peter Canellos announced in a staff memo Monday titled “The Politico Class of 2015.” — Thompson currently serves as Washington bureau chief for Reuters.

Harry Sloan, Jeff Sagansky Make $303 Million Investment in Indian Pay-TV Service — Veteran Hollywood executives Harry Sloan and Jeff Sagansky are investing at least $303.7 million to acquire 33.5% of Videocon d2h, a pay-TV service in India that provides direct-to-home broadcasts.

Sony CEO praises employees, partners for standing up to hackers — (Reuters) - Sony Corp Chief Executive Officer Kazuo Hirai on Monday praised employees and partners of the company's Hollywood movie studio for standing up to “extortionist efforts” of hackers who attacked Sony Pictures Entertainment in November.
